The Immediate and Systemic Brain and Body Impacts of Smoking Beyond Lung Disease

Watch on YouTube

Summary

The podcast challenges the common perception that smoking's dangers are limited to lung cancer and emphysema, arguing that its detrimental effects are far more pervasive and immediate. It highlights two primary mechanisms: carbon monoxide poisoning and oxidative stress. Carbon monoxide significantly reduces oxygen delivery to all cells, particularly the brain, impairing its function. Simultaneously, the inhalation of free radicals initiates a powerful pro-inflammatory oxidative process linked to a wide array of degenerative diseases. The speaker emphasizes that these effects are not just long-term risks but immediate physiological impacts, occurring "as soon as you've smoked." A crucial nuance is that these processes occur even "if you don't notice anything" or "don't have symptoms," underscoring the insidious nature of smoking's damage. The brain's unique sensitivity to fuel delivery (oxygen and glucose) is highlighted as a key distinction, making it particularly vulnerable to carbon monoxide's effects. The broader implications extend beyond respiratory health to systemic degeneration, linking smoking directly to the pathogenesis of conditions like diabetes, heart disease, stroke, and Alzheimer's. This reframes smoking not just as a habit affecting one organ system but as a catalyst for widespread chronic illness, significantly hindering the body's natural healing processes and predisposing individuals to a multitude of severe health conditions.
